Responsibilities
Manage and execute resource management process for assigned population
Facilitate scheduling of resources to appropriate client assignments based on timing, travel, levels, skills, and other necessary requirements
Drive scheduling process to prepare for future deadlines; balance capacity with open needs and proposing solutions to maximize utilization and drive profitability
Use scheduling tools to forecast hours, track utilization, and monitor overall headcount
Facilitate meetings with Managers and Partners on a weekly basis, providing updates as needed
Ensure staff profiles and schedules are accurately maintained in the scheduling database; making necessary changes on a recurring basis
Generate and analyze resource management reports, including availability reports, billable hour forecasts and actual vs scheduled variance data
Monitor chargeable hours, overtime, and travel to ensure work is fairly distributed
Drive consistency by implementing resource management processes and teaming with personnel to ensure compliance
Build relationships with client serving personnel at all levels through effective communications and a high degree of professionalism
Gain understanding of the skills, experiences, and career goals of professional staff to ensure optimal client assignments alignments
Proactively communicate with Managers, Partners and industry leaders to ensure population is effectively utilized
Facilitate the resolution of conflicting assignments and flag availability of staff to ensure engagements are staffed appropriately
Field scheduling questions, tailoring responses based as needed; elevating to Manager of Resource Management when necessary
Collaborate across Firm functions and within internal team
Liaise with resource managers across other business units for effective and efficient allocation of resources
Support strategic resource management projects and initiatives throughout the year
Coordinate with the human resource and recruiting teams on the hiring and on-boarding of campus and experienced hire talent, including intern programs
Participation in semi-annual and annual performance calibration meetings for professional staff

Overview
Baker Tilly US, LLP (Baker Tilly) is a leading advisory, tax and assurance firm, providing clients a genuine coast-to-coast and global advantage with critical mass and top-notch talent in major regions of the U.S. and in many of the world's leading financial centers - New York, London, San Francisco, Los Angeles and Chicago. Baker Tilly is an independent member of Baker Tilly International, a worldwide network of independent accounting and business advisory firms in 148 territories, with 36,000 professionals and a combined worldwide revenue of $4.0 billion.
